Opening a microbrewery in the midst of COVID-19

The Joint Chemical Engineering Committee (JCEC) NSW welcomes you to their first event for 2021.

Bracket Brewing is a small family owned brewery run by father and son duo, Mark and Mike. The brewery has forgone the typical core range of beers and instead focuses on small batches of one-off’s with the goal that each time you visit the taproom there will be something new to try.

After four years of planning, Bracket Brewing opened their doors in August 2020. In early 2020, Mark and Mike had to make some tough decisions, including almost throwing in the towel as COVID-19 lead to significant cost increases and supply chain challenges before they had even opened. The talk will cover the economics of a nanobrewery, and the challenges to open and operate the brewery in 2020.

About the brewers

Mike studied Molecular Biology & Genetics at university. In his last year after taking a number of food tech electives he found a passion for all things fermented. That rabbit hole ultimately lead to the opening of Bracket Brewing. He has worked at a number of breweries and distilleries in Australia and the UK and studied a Masters in Brewing & Distilling through Heriot Watt University in Edinburgh.

Mark, up until recently, was a Senior Check Captain on the Boeing 747, flying long haul international routes. As a parallel career he studied to become a Lawyer being admitted in 2014. With the onset of the pandemic he was stood down as a pilot and eventually made redundant. This allowed him to focus on his career as a Lawyer as well as setting up the brewery.
